So, 'Vilma Doesn’t Work Today' is this quirky little animation that really leans into the absurdity of everyday life. You've got Varis, who carries the weight of the world—or at least his tired eyes—while Mirdza's sour cream business adds a slice of reality. The old Lung and its gum-spitting antics introduce a surreal twist, of course. It’s not just about plot; the atmosphere is drenched in a playful, offbeat tone that keeps you guessing. The pacing feels almost dreamlike, where time bends and you get lost in the digital transformation of the Megapixel. There’s something unique about animation here, too, with a raw charm that feels handcrafted, even when it’s all about tech. It’s odd, it’s bizarre, but it somehow resonates. Just don’t expect traditional storytelling.
